How they compare

Bahamas currently reports 37.1% against 36.9% in Uganda, a difference of 0.2%.

The two have swapped places 7 times across 55 shared years of data; in 1967 it was Uganda ahead.

Bahamas ranks 15th and Uganda ranks 16th of 204 countries.

Uganda has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Merchandise exports to low- and middle-income economies in Sub-Saharan Africa are the sum of merchandise exports from the reporting economy to low- and middle-income economies in the Sub-Saharan Africa region according to World Bank classification of economies. Data are as a percentage of total merchandise exports by the economy. Data are computed only if at least half of the economies in the partner country group had non-missing data.
